Paul and the Religious Experience of Reconciliation
Diasporic Community and Creole Consciousness
Gilbert I. Bond

In the ancient world as in contemporary times, religion provides a vital context in which people become who they are and establish themselves with a unique identity. This process of constructing the self is not only a psychological process and a phenomenological reality; it can also be a deeply religious experience.
